Linux kernel BPF LSM hooks called in atomic contexts can cause kernel panic/DoS.

affected
Linux kernel (BPF LSM)Linux distributions with BPF LSM enabled
impact

Local attacker or malicious BPF LSM can sleep in atomic context causing kernel panic/DoS and potential privilege escalation.

vendor says fixed in< 5.11, >= 5.15.209 and <= 5.15.*, >= 6.1.175 and <= 6.1.*, >= 6.6.141 and <= 6.6.*, >= 6.12.91 and <= 6.12.*, >= 6.18.33 and <= 6.18.*, >= 7.0.10 and <= 7.0.*, >= 7.1 and <= *

As published in the CVE Program record. A version outside these ranges is not a statement that it is unaffected — vendors sometimes understate a range, and distribution-backported builds carry upstream numbers that do not reflect what was patched into them.
